2023 BATHURST 6 HOUR RESULTS


Class winners in Bold.
Good to see the Local Legends Quinn Mustang Mach1 winning the A2 Class.... Ryan Quinn passing the Century 21 Mustang in the last 100 metres to win it by 9/100ths
Class C was also decided on the last lap and saw an extraordinary conclusion as the HSV VXR of Brock Giblin/Ben McLeod overcame a driveshaft failure in the final 30 minutes to claim victory in 15th outright after the HSV VRX of Chris Holdt/David Ling/Darren Jenkins lost the lead on the final lap.

The very late SC was the 12th of the race and a record over the previous 11.
Also the first time the race has been actually suspended with a red.

Motorsport Australia Trophy Series Round 1 - Sydney Motorsport Park

The inaugural round of the Shannons Trophy Series at Sydney Motorsport Park.

The Trophy Series was created to meet the current demand for national-level motorsport in Australia.

The first round of the all-new Motorsport Australia-sanctioned series features categories such as Mobil 1 Australian Production Cars and Monochrome GT4 Australia Series, MARC Cars Australia, TGRA Scholarship Series, Workhorse Radical Cup Australia, Improved Production and Excels.

GEOGHEGAN Grandson a triple winner this weekend at SMP's T86 races

First a bit of background..... Max Geoghegan, grandson of the late five-time Australian Touring Car Champion Ian 'Pete' Geoghegan, made his race debut in the Hyundai Excel series at QIR a year ago, but put the family name back in the winners circle with a win on debut.

Image
Max Geoghegan leads a pack of Excels, winning on debut.

Max is a friend of T888 race winner Broc Feeney, who has been giving Max driver coaching. Max had grown up loving Motor Sport but never got into karting or anything. He decided last year to have a go in the Excel series 'for a bit of fun' knowing friends in the series. He is also friends with Nash (son of Paul) Morris.

He bought the Excel on a Wednesday, took it out to the Morris Family testing grounds at Norwell on theThursday and rocked up to practice at QIR on the Friday. On the Saturday he came 6th, but Sunday he came 3rd and followed up with a win in the 3rd race of his debut weekend. Broc Feeney and Broc's Father Paul were Max's crew and helpers, helped him set up the car, with Broc giving Max tips on what he was doing well and where he could be better. Ian 'Pete' Geoghegan won 4 straight ATCC Titles from 1966 on in big powerful Mustangs, having won his first title in 1964 driving a Cortina GT. Ian in turn had got the motorsport bug from his Father Tom, a successful Sydney car dealer who was also a competitor.

Image
Ian (Pete) finesses the Mustang into The Viaduct at Longford

Of course Ian's brother Leo had also got the racing bug....his career was more towards open wheelers, and he collected a swag of some ten titles in his career. Leo actually started in Touring cars with a black Holden, affectionately known "Old Number One" in 1956. He raced that for a few years before racing (Lotus) Sports Cars and then Open Wheelers with a couple of very successful Lotuses. (So successful that the Geoghegan's became the Lotus distributor in Australia..) .... Leo also bought and raced the ex Jim Clark Tasman Series Lotus 39 Climax. That always suffered engine issues and was converted to run a 2.5 litre Repco V8.

Image
"Old #1" Holden.... Leo Geoghegan Bathurst 1958

Leo always liked Bathurst so Touring cars were still a one or two off annual foray (the 6 hour and the 500mile/1000ks). Ian and Leo did drive Bathurst together, finishing second driving a Ford XR Falcon GT in 1967. Actually they took the chequered flag first, but a protest by teammate Harry Firth saw the brothers relegated to second after a re-count of the lap charts. (Unfortunately their Falcon had run out of petrol after it had passed the pits. Leo was able to drive through the back gate into the pits to be refuelled, which led the lap scorers to mistakenly credit the Ford with a lap it did not complete – although Leo always disputed this.)

Image
Ian and Leo Bathurst 1967
